Russia finishes in seventh place

 

Callao, Peru, August 16, 2015 – Russia defeated Poland 3-0 (25-14, 25-18, 25-16) in the match for the seventh place of the FIVB Volleyball Girls’ U18 World Championship at Miguel Grau Coliseum of Callao on Sunday.

Angelina Lazarenko and Maria Voroyeba topped Russia with 17 and 14 points, respectively, while Aleksandra Rasinska and Natalia Murek finished with 11 and 8 for Poland.

The winners held advantages in attacks (29-22), blocks (8-3) and aces (13-6) while benefitting from 25 unforced errors committed by the losers only making 17 of their own.

With an amazing performance of the middleblocker Angelina Lazarenko, Russia controlled the polish game and closed the first set 25 -14, the game finished with an spike point form Ksenia Smirnova.

Poland had many troubles in the reception and their defense never worked, that complicated the job of setter Agata Michalewicz. Russia took advantage of these problems and held the technical time outs with the score 8-6 and 16 -8, finally they won the second set 25- 18.

With a powerful serve, Russia led the entire third set, and taking advantage of the continuing mistakes in the polish side they led the set from start to end, finally the game finished with a serving error from Aleksandra Rasinka giving Russia the point 25 over 16.

Russia won 3 – 0, taking the 7th place.
